After being mechanically sorted by Group 2 Motorsports in Seattle. WA. this car was driven from the West Coast to Connecticut in 2008.

After arriving in CT the original engine was swapped with a rebuilt engine. including a modification to the GoTech EFI. The car was dyno'd at 120HP at 5700 rpm and received new driveshaft donuts.

The CT owner sold the car to another CT Alfetta enthusiast in 2012. When his collection became too large he sold me the GTV one year ago this March.

Engine runs very strong with no issues and the transmission shifts smoothly with no issues. including no synchro issues. Suspension w/ Bilstein shocks is solid. car needs nothing. Battery has been moved to trunk.  

There were some rust spots in the body panels which were all removed. Body work and paint done by Artisan Autobody of Manassas. VA. who did a fantastic job. There was and is no structural rust which is very impressive for an Alfetta and speaks to both its West Coast heritage and good care by its East Coast owners over the past eight years. Inner fender areas are completely clean apart from one small place where there is an old surface scab which had formed under a factory sticker and has been treated with rust converter; it sits several inches safely behind the strut tower.

The chin spoiler (spoilers as it comes in two pieces) was removed prior to paint and not re-attached (personal preference) but is included with the car.
